Flexibility in Printing on Various Surfaces and Materials
The ability of CIJ printers to print on a diverse range of surfaces and materials is one of their most significant advantages. Unlike other marking technologies that require specific surface types or conditions, CIJ printers operate with great adaptability. They can print on materials such as plastics, glass, metals, paper, cardboard, and even irregular or curved surfaces without compromising print quality. This flexibility makes them incredibly useful across different industries, including food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, automotive, electronics, and cosmetics.
This adaptability largely stems from the unique ink delivery mechanism of CIJ technology. The ink is ejected as a continuous stream that is deflected by electrostatic plates to precisely form the desired characters or images. Due to this non-contact printing method, CIJ printers do not require direct contact with the substrate, which minimizes the risk of damaging fragile surfaces or interrupting the flow of the production line. Moreover, CIJ inks are available in various formulations, including solvent-based, UV-curable, and water-based inks, tailored to bond effectively with different material types. This ensures high adhesion, durability, and resistance to smudging, abrasion, and environmental factors.
Another aspect of CIJ printer flexibility is their capacity to handle diverse product sizes and shapes. Production lines often involve items ranging from small bottles to large containers or flat packages to unevenly shaped objects. The versatility of CIJ printers allows manufacturers to mark every product consistently without needing to adjust or change equipment extensively. This reduces downtime and costs associated with switching marking systems and offers a streamlined operation that handles multiple product lines effortlessly.
Additionally, CIJ printing supports a wide variety of mark types that include date codes, batch numbers, barcodes, logos, and even complex graphics. The breadth of printable content makes it easier for manufacturers to implement traceability and branding directly on products, packaging, or secondary labeling, providing essential information to customers and regulatory bodies.
High-Speed Printing Capabilities to Maximize Efficiency
On fast-paced production lines, speed is critical. CIJ printers are designed to operate at very high speeds, often exceeding several hundred meters per minute, which allows continuous marking without slowing down manufacturing throughput. This high-speed capability significantly boosts overall productivity and supports lean manufacturing practices.
CIJ printers maintain ink deposition even on rapidly moving products by modulating the jet frequency in synchronization with the line speed. This continuous ink stream technology is inherently suited to high-speed environments, avoiding the performance limitations encountered by contact or drop-on-demand printers. As a result, manufacturers experience minimal bottlenecks caused by marking operations.
The ability to print on the fly—without requiring the product to stop or pause—ensures better integration with automated packaging and conveying systems. This seamless operation reduces manual handling, which minimizes human error and contributes to better workplace safety and ergonomics. Continuous printing also eliminates the need for periodic stops that are typical with batch printing systems, enhancing valve consistency and reducing mechanical wear on the equipment.
Moreover, CIJ printers can handle complex print jobs without sacrificing speed. Whether printing intricate logos, detailed graphics, or variable text such as expiration dates or QR codes, the system maintains high-quality output without compromising line speed. This versatility combined with speed is invaluable for industries that require both precision and throughput, such as pharmaceutical labeling or high-volume consumer goods packaging.
Another speed-related advantage is the swift startup and shutdown cycles. Many modern CIJ printers come equipped with advanced software controls and diagnostics that optimize the printing process immediately when activated. This minimizes waste typically associated with warmed-up ink and wasted product or material during printer initialization.
Cost-Effectiveness and Reduced Operational Expenses
While some may assume advanced printing technology entails high costs, CIJ printers often provide excellent cost-efficiency over their operational lifecycle. This benefit arises from several factors related to their design, ink consumption, maintenance, and operational flexibility.
First, although CIJ inks can be specialized, their consumption is relatively economical due to the sophisticated control over drop size and jet frequency. Unlike some printers that require frequent ink replacement or use excess consumables, CIJ printers maintain a steady, minimal ink usage that reduces waste. Furthermore, with continuous operation, there is less downtime to manage and less disruption in production, translating into lower labor costs and higher output.
Additionally, modern CIJ printers are engineered for durability, requiring less frequent servicing and parts replacement compared to older or other types of printers. Their maintenance schedules are often straightforward and supported by user-friendly diagnostics that alert operators to potential issues before they escalate. This preventive maintenance capability avoids costly repairs and unexpected production halts.
Because CIJ printers can handle multiple substrates and product types, manufacturers can reduce their equipment footprint by standardizing on a single marking system rather than employing various machines for different lines. This consolidation lowers capital expenditure and simplifies training and inventory management.
Moreover, CIJ technology often supports the use of eco-friendly and cost-efficient inks, including quick-drying solvent blends and water-based formulas. These ink options not only align with environmental regulations but also reduce the overall health and disposal costs associated with more toxic consumables.
The adaptability to frequent changes in printing content without additional tooling or plates also enhances cost savings. This means businesses can quickly update batch codes, dates, or promotional messages with minimal interruption and no extra expenses, supporting agile manufacturing practices.
Enhanced Print Quality and Durability for Reliable Traceability
The accuracy and clarity of product marking are crucial for compliance, brand integrity, and consumer safety. CIJ printers are renowned for providing high-resolution print quality that is sharp, legible, and consistent even in demanding production conditions.
Using advanced ink formulations and precision jet control, CIJ printers create fine characters, barcodes, and symbols that meet the strict standards required by many regulatory agencies. The ability to print variable data with clarity ensures that essential product information such as lot numbers, expiration dates, serial numbers, and traceability codes can be read reliably by both human operators and automated scanning devices.
Durability of the printed marks is equally important. CIJ inks are engineered to resist common challenges such as smudging, abrasion, moisture exposure, and chemical contact. Many inks also have UV-curable or fast-drying properties ensuring immediate set once printed, avoiding smears and ensuring production line productivity.
Additionally, variable marking capacities support anti-counterfeiting measures by enabling batch-specific or serialized printing on every product unit. This capability helps businesses trace products throughout their lifecycle and detect potential fraud or product recalls promptly.
The precision of CIJ printing also maintains product aesthetics, preventing the degradation of packaging appearance that could arise from inconsistent or low-resolution marks. This focus on quality supports brand reputation and consumer confidence, especially in luxury goods or regulated industries where packaging design plays a significant role.
Modern CIJ systems incorporate user-friendly interfaces to set and review print content easily, ensuring that mistakes or printing errors are minimized. Some models also offer inspection cameras and quality control features to catch any defects early in the process, further improving reliability.
Minimal Downtime and Ease of Integration in Production Lines
Downtime in a production setting can be costly and disruptive. CIJ printers provide significant advantages in minimizing operational interruptions, making them ideal for integration into complex, continuous manufacturing environments.
The design of CIJ printers emphasizes reliability and ease of maintenance. They feature automated cleaning and flushing cycles that reduce the need for manual intervention. This helps maintain continuous printer readiness without lengthy shutdowns for maintenance. Operators can carry out routine checks and ink refills quickly and safely, often without stopping the production line, supporting near 24/7 operation.
Integration capabilities also set CIJ printers apart. They are engineered to interface smoothly with diverse packaging and conveyor systems, accommodating sensors, line controls, and data inputs for synchronized operation. This connectivity enables real-time printing adjustments based on batch data feeds or production metrics, reducing human error and improving traceability.
Because CIJ printers do not require physical contact with the product, they are easy to position and adjust within existing line configurations. They also come with compact footprints that adapt well to space-constrained environments without disrupting workflows.
Advances in software and networking options allow remote monitoring and troubleshooting, enabling technical support teams to diagnose and solve issues without the need for onsite visits. This remote accessibility further reduces downtime and increases overall equipment effectiveness.
Furthermore, quick and intuitive changeovers accommodate product line switches with minimal setup effort. Variables such as font size, print position, and ink type can be adjusted via touchscreen controls or automated recipes, enhancing production flexibility while keeping downtime to a minimum.
In summary, the robust design, intelligent automation, and integration-friendly architecture of CIJ printers result in a highly reliable marking solution that supports continuous manufacturing demands with minimal operational disruptions.
